Step 6: Enabling offline mode for the Terrafield survey app. Confirm that the sync queue persists to encrypted local storage and that conflict resolution defaults to server-wins, as reviewed in the offline-sync module. Build the offline bundle with the release profile only; debug builds skip integrity checks. Before pushing the bundle to the Terrafield distribution channel, sign it with the deploy key that appears immediately below.

rollout seal: bky9_PeXH1fTLY

Subject: On-call handover — Flexiscale autoscaler

Hey Priya,

Handing over the pager. The queue-depth autoscaler on the Brindlewood cluster got twitchy over the weekend — it scaled the ingest workers up to 40 twice on tiny bursts. I bumped the cooldown from 60s to 180s and it's been calm since. Watch the depth graph for the midday spike; if it oscillates again, just pin the worker count at 12 and file a ticket with the Flexiscale folks.

If support asks about the scaling blips, point them here first.

escalation mailbox, bafog-fafog: ulador@paliqlabs.internal

The retention sweeper (svc-reaper) runs nightly at 02:15 UTC. It deletes rows older than the policy window from events, sessions, and audit_shadow. Batch size is 5,000; deletes are soft for 7 days, then hard. Policy windows live in retention_rules and are owned by the Graywick platform team. Review the batching logic before approving changes. The sweeper connects to the archive store using the connection string below.

primary connection of tajeg-tajop = postgresql://julax_svc:DI@db-e7f3.kelvidyn.corp:5432/rusdor

/*
 * Seat-map grid width for the Pellwright Theatre renderer.
 * Support team: if a patron reports overlapping seats in row AA,
 * check whether their cached layout predates this constant's last
 * change — stale caches render the old 28-column grid against new
 * coordinates. Clearing the venue cache resolves it in every case
 * we've seen. Confirm the client is on the build matching the
 * token immediately below.
 */

pipeline stamp: htk3_69f